Ray
(the quiet man) Johnson
finally delivers the
game he had always
talked so eloquently
about in the passed ten
years. Ray holed a
twelve foot putt to win
his first Major at Gatton Manor over Keith
Murray. At the 19th
Ray praised his playing
partners who were very
generous in their
encouragement, guidance
and praise, especially
when the wheels started
to come off.
Well done
Ray ….finally, others
who fell at his feet
were Tony "1 finger"
Irish in third place and
Roger Goddard and Malcolm
O'Garro in fourth and
fifth respectively..
